An educator who implemented Russian education standards in the seized university in Kherson was suspected.

This was reported by the press service of the Kherson Regional Prosecutor's Office.

The post says that under the procedural guidance of the Kherson Regional Prosecutor's Office, a former associate professor of a university in the regional center was served in absentia with a notice of suspicion of collaboration (Part 3 of Article 111-1 of the Criminal Code of Ukraine).

Thus, according to the investigation, in the summer of 2022, the suspect collaborated with the enemy and took the position of "dean" of one of the faculties of the Kherson National Technical University, which was seized by the occupiers. In his pseudo-position, the suspect began to implement Russian education standards and taught courses exclusively in Russian. He was in charge of the general management of the faculty, approved the class schedule and coordinated the settlement of students in the dormitory.

The pre-trial investigation is being conducted by investigators of the Main Department of the National Police in Kherson region.

Earlier it was reported that a woman who wasthe "head of the village" under the occupiers would be tried in Kherson region. The investigation found that in September 2022, the accused cooperated with the occupiers and took the position of the so-called "head of the Kirov village council" of the Beryslav occupation administration. In her pseudo-position, the woman took measures to establish the occupation authorities in the area. She ensured the functioning of the illegally created authority, recruited employees, and disposed of the village's communal property. She agitated the local population to cooperate with the enemy and obtain a Russian passport.
